maven compiles java projects in jdk 1.4 mode while running java 1.7?

I have a big maven project divided to some modules.

I decided to give the pmd (code quality check) module with maven.

when I try to test the pmd module using the command

mvn pmd:pmd

I get the following types of warnings:

looks like maven compiles the projects using jdk 1.4 for some reason.

so any ideas how to make sure that maven will compile for jdk 1.7 and not 1.4 ?

I googled and found usage examples of the maven-compiler-plugin as found in the following url: http://twit88.com/blog/2008/03/09/maven-compile-your-application-to-be-14-15-or-16-compatible/

unfortunately the results are exactly the same.

What you need is to tell the target version of PMD:

<build>
  <pluginManagement>
    <plugins>
      <plugin>
      <groupId>org.apache.maven.plugins</groupId>
      <artifactId>maven-pmd-plugin</artifactId>
      <version>2.7.1</version>
      <configuration>
          <targetJdk>1.7</targetJdk>
          <rulesets>
              <ruleset>tools/pmd-rules.xml</ruleset>
          </rulesets>
      </configuration>
    </plugin>
    <plugin>
        <groupId>org.apache.maven.plugins</groupId>
        <artifactId>maven-compiler-plugin</artifactId>
        <version>2.5.1</version>
        <configuration>
            <source>1.7</source>
            <target>1.7</target>
        </configuration>
    </plugin>

    </plugins>
  </pluginManagement>
</build>

<reporting>
    <plugins>
        <plugin>
            <groupId>org.apache.maven.plugins</groupId>
            <artifactId>maven-pmd-plugin</artifactId>
            <version>2.7.1</version>
        </plugin>
    </plugins>
</reporting>

Note: A few month ago the 1.7 JDK was not supported, you should double check it in the documentation, otherwise you won't be able to use the diamond syntax.

In pom.xml:

<build>
    <plugins>
        <plugin>
            <groupId>org.apache.maven.plugins</groupId>
            <artifactId>maven-compiler-plugin</artifactId>
            <version>2.5.1</version>
            <configuration>
                <source>1.7</source>
                <target>1.7</target>
            </configuration>
        </plugin>
    </plugins>
</build>
